Wednesday morning, October 24th, 2012.

Susana Perez-Ruelas, 34, has picked up her 13-year-old son, Antonio Jr, from school for a dentist appointment. She and her husband, Antonio Sr, have been having some financial problems. Their home is in foreclosure. They've listed their 2010 Camaro for sale on Craigslist.

Google Maps street view
While her son waits in the car, Susana stops by United States Fire Protection, the equipment store her husbands co-owns in Downey, and finds two employees dead. Susana's mother-in-law has been shot as well but survives.

Jade Douglas Harris has come for the car.

It's at Susana's home.

Harris forces her to take him to it. At their house, according to a spokeswoman for the business, Antonio Jr offers the Camaro's key in exchange for their safety. Harris raises his gun to the boy's head and threatens him, at which point Susana shoves the assailant. Susana is shot and killed. Antonio Jr is shot. The robber leaves with the Camaro.

Apparently Harris had driven to the first crime scene. KTLA reports that the next day he attempted to retrieve a vehicle he left outside the business, but did not find it there and called police to report it stolen. He was told that he could come pick it up and was arrested doing so.


Arraignment has been postponed until November 28th. Harris may face the death penalty, which California voters recently retained.
